Posterior reversible encephalopathy syndrome (PRES) as a complication of Guillain-Barre’ syndrome (GBS)
A 17-year-old Pakistani female patient presented with acute onset flaccid quadriparesis with nerve conduction studies showing demyelinating polyneuropathy consistent with Guillain-Barre’ syndrome.
